
Officials in the great state of Montana just released their 2025 Annual Wolf Report and some of the figures contained inside are difficult to ignore. With previous estimates pointing to about 1,094 wolves in the Treasure State, a newly refined version of their population model has dropped that number to about 725 wolves, marking a 34 percent reduction that is now also suggesting that the number of wolves in the state has been on the decline for the last five years.
In response to their findings, FWP is now proposing to slash quotas from last year’s number of 452 to 250 for the 2026-27 hunting season.
What Actually Changed in the Model
For the last number of years, Montana FWP has relied on the integrated Patch Occupancy Model, or iPOM, to estimate wolf numbers. Using a three-pronged approach, this model combines three main pieces including an occupancy model that estimates how much of the state is occupied by wolves, a territory-size model, and a group-size (pack-size) model. The math usually operates by multiplying the predicted number of packs by average pack size, adding in a few loners and dispersers, and eventually arriving at a statewide estimate.
The original iPOM (iPOM 1.0) system leaned heavily on high-quality field observations that included “good-quality” counts usually from repeated observations and/or radio-collared canines and leaned towards larger pack sizes.
However, as time went on, biologists began to notice that more moderate-quality observations like hunter reports, single sightings, and track surveys were consistently showing smaller average pack sizes than the good-quality data, and that gap seemed to be growing. Over the past few years, that moderate-quality data eventually became a larger share of the dataset, and leaving it out was starting to look like a systemic upward bias.
Now with an updated 2.0 model that is incorporating both the good- and moderate-quality data from 2007-2025, the average pack size is being pulled downward, hence lowering the overall population estimate. The change is being described by FWP as a fine-tuning of sorts, driven by additional years of Montana-specific data, rather than a sudden collapse in the wolf population itself.

“It’s a refinement of our modeling process,” said Quentin Kujala, FWP’s chief of conservation policy.
For the time being, the agency has said that they are presenting both estimates while the updated 2.0 model makes its way through the peer review process.
If there’s one thing both sides of the wolf debate can agree on, it’s that nobody wants to manage animals based on bad numbers. Beyond that, the consensus mostly evaporates.
Anti-hunting groups maintain that the newly-proposed 250-wolf quota is still too aggressive, all while conveniently ignoring the fact that quotas are traditionally never even close to being filled anyways. Last year’s harvest numbers, for example, were the lowest on record since 2016.

As for hunters and trappers, the new model is doing nothing but raising legitimate questions about just how things changed so drastically. Field reports in some areas just don’t seem to match the picture of a steadily declining population, leaving more than a few of us wondering how a coding refinement and the inclusion of moderate-quality sightings produced such staggering results.
Either way, if the data ends up being the gold standard, a harvest of 250 wolves (assuming the quota gets filled) would still leave the population well above the state’s minimum threshold of 450 wolves, which is the number tied to maintaining 15 breeding pairs under the current management plan.
“We get a bad rap all the time, people on my side,” Chris Morgan, president of the Montana Trappers Association said. “We just want them managed appropriately. And maybe that’s killing wolves and maybe that’s not. But having the data to be able to do that is key.”
In short, it would seem that both camps are truly after better information. They just seem to disagree on what that information is currently telling them to do.
